Q1.What types of funeral services are commonly offered by funeral homes in Waldo, Wisconsin?

Funeral homes in Waldo typically offer traditional funeral services, cremation options, and memorial services. Many also provide pre-planning assistance and grief support, with some incorporating local customs or accommodating rural community needs in Sheboygan County.

Q2.How much does a funeral typically cost in Waldo, WI, and what factors affect the price?

In Waldo, a standard funeral can range from $7,000 to $12,000, depending on services chosen. Costs are influenced by the type of service (burial vs. cremation), casket selection, and additional options like transportation or obituaries, with Wisconsin requiring price transparency under state law.

Q3.Are there any local regulations in Waldo or Wisconsin that affect burial or cremation?

Yes, Wisconsin state law requires a 24-hour waiting period before cremation and a permit for burial or cremation issued by the local registrar. In Waldo, as part of Sheboygan County, additional rules may apply for cemetery plots, so it's best to consult with a local funeral director.

Q4.What should I consider when choosing a funeral home in Waldo, WI?

Consider the funeral home's reputation, service options, and pricing transparency. In Waldo's small community, personal recommendations and proximity to local cemeteries or churches can be important, along with whether they offer flexible arrangements for rural residents.

Q5.Can I pre-plan a funeral in Waldo, and are there benefits to doing so?

Yes, most funeral homes in Waldo offer pre-planning services, allowing you to arrange details in advance. This can lock in costs, ease the burden on family, and ensure your wishes are met according to Wisconsin's pre-need funeral contract regulations.

A funeral director's role begins with the initial call, offering immediate support and clear, step-by-step guidance. They handle the sensitive and respectful care of your loved one, ensuring all procedures follow Wisconsin state regulations and your family's wishes. For many families in Waldo and the surrounding Ozaukee County area, this includes arranging transportation from a home, hospital, or care facility. Your funeral director will then sit down with you for a detailed arrangement conference. This is a time to discuss everything from the type of service—be it a traditional funeral, a memorial service, or a celebration of life—to the selection of a casket or urn, floral arrangements, and music. They listen to your stories and help weave personal touches into the service, whether it's displaying photos from a lifetime spent in Waldo or incorporating a favorite hymn.

Beyond the ceremony itself, funeral directors manage a multitude of behind-the-scenes tasks that relieve immense pressure from grieving families. They prepare and file the death certificate, work with local cemeteries like Immanuel Lutheran Cemetery or St. Mary's, and coordinate with clergy or celebrants. They also assist with obituary placement in local publications and online, helping to inform the community. A key part of their service is providing resources for grief support, connecting families with local counseling services or support groups in the Sheboygan and Ozaukee areas.
